A man is being interviewed by a television crew. The figures are clustered in the lower half of the frame, leaving a vast expanse of empty space above—where, in turn, their reflection appears.
The artist uses his painting to draw analogies with reality, constructing fictional parallel worlds based on situations he has witnessed and experienced. His paintings are grounded in actual encounters, objects, or spaces. They do not tell stories; instead, they present a moment devoid of a "before" or "after," defined by the arrangement of figures within the space, the way light falls across architectural settings, and the interplay of colors.
